Let Your Ark Rise Above The Earth

“Then the flood came upon the earth for forty days, and the water increased and lifted up the ark, so that it rose above the earth”

Genesis 7:17


The word of God in Jesus Christ, which this world rejects, is the same word that we have received and, as a result, we have been lifted up in our ark of salvation so we may rise “above the earth.”


It is as the apostle Paul wrote, “Therefore if you have been raised up with Christ, keep seeking the things above, where Christ is, seated at the right hand of God” (Colossians 3:1).


In Noah’s day the water of judgement which came upon the earth was the same water that lifted him up so that he “rose above the earth.”


Similarly, the judgements of the people of the earth today, without Christ, are always submerged under the waters (of humanity) of this world. Whereas the judgements of God in Jesus Christ lift the child of God above the waters of humanity so that we might rise above the earth and live a new life in and with our Lord .


Rise above the earth today, beloved, in the praises of your God as you minister in His presence.


Let God lift your ark of safety and salvation up above the judgments of this world.


In Jesus Christ we are saved and lifted so we might rise above all things of this world, in victory and safety, continually rising up, becoming closer to our Lord all the time.


Child of God, drinking the waters of this world can drag you down and out of God’s presence in a flash. So, drink the living, loving, waters of Jesus Christ instead and become “lifted” up in your ark so you may, by God’s grace, rise up “above the earth.”


Yes, rise up with thanksgiving and gratitude in the presence of your God Who has called you to Himself. Hallelujah!
